Are there any people under the age of 40 who have ever thought markets were something besides a casino? Meme trades aren’t the cause of widespread Schneier-Quotesdistrust, they’re the symptoms of it. And those people under 40 who think finance is for gambling? They’re the lucrative part of Robinhood’s user base. Legal issues aside, it seems like Robinhood has a good business model for monetizing financial nihilism—which is the kind of thing investors might get excited about.
